4. Formal Translation
Be ashamed, Sidon, for the sea, the stronghold of the sea, has spoken, saying, “I have not travailed, nor have I given birth, nor have I raised young men, nor have I brought up virgins.”
4. Dynamic Translation
Feel shame, Sidon, for the sea fortress has declared, “I have neither endured labor nor given birth; I have neither reared young men nor brought up maidens.”
